CoD Mobile Season 9 is here, as the popular handheld title gears up for another big Halloween event. From new weapons and maps to the return of Undead Siege, here’s included in the huge October 20 update.

Another new season in CoD Mobile has finally arrived after Season 8 and the second-anniversary celebrations begin to wind down. As always, players are in store for another massive update with tons of new content on the way.

Season 9 brings the fright again for Halloween: From spooky map overhauls to a frightening ‘Nightmare’ theme, the devs are going all in for the 2021 spectacle.

CoD Mobile Season 9 Nightmare theme
As The Haunting takes over in Black Ops Cold War and Warzone, the Nightmare is taking over CoD Mobile.

CoD Mobile Season 9’s theme is a chilling one as the Halloween celebrations take full effect. From creepy skins to scary menus, every aspect of CoD Mobile has been tweaked to provide a true Nightmare-inducing experience.

New CoD Mobile Season 9 maps
No different from every recent season, CoD Mobile Season 9 has brought with it some interesting new maps.

First up is Hovec Sawmill, another map from 2019’s Modern Warfare making the jump to CoD Mobile. This medium-sized map features multiple lanes, a mix of verticality, and opportunities for both indoor and outdoor engagements.

Fitting the Halloween theme, the CoD Mobile rendition has Hovec Sawmill set at night, so be sure to crank your brightness up.

Next is the return of Halloween Standoff in CoD Mobile Season 9. While the original version of the map quickly became a fan favorite, the yearly Halloween overhaul has become iconic.

Halloween Standoff functions just the same way as before, though CoD Mobile devs have teased “new content” in this year’s iteration of the famous map. We’ll be sure to keep you updated as we learn of any new features or easter eggs.

New weapons in CoD Mobile Season 9
Two new weapons have arrived in CoD Mobile’s Season 9 update and both should be familiar to longtime fans of the series.

Up first is the Thumper, a deadly Grenade Launcher that’s featured in numerous mainline CoD titles. Scoring a direct hit with a projectile from the Thumper will secure a single-shot kill more often than not. Next, we have a more recent addition joining the mix in CoD Mobile Season 9 as the Swordfish Tactical Rifle will soon be available. Players will be able to grab this classic gun at Tier 21 of the Season 9 Battle Pass.

This four-round burst weapon first appeared in Black Ops 4 and while it may have a slow rate of fire, it packs one hell of a punch in any gunfight.

CoD Mobile Season 9 Battle Pass
As players have come to expect with each new season in CoD Mobile, another fresh Battle Pass is indeed available to grind in Season 9.

The first battle pass reveal came on October 18, with devs confirming a new Operator Skill for the rewards track. The TAK 5 Operator Skill – unlocked at Tier 14 – instantly gets your entire team back to full health, and even overheals an extra 50 HP on top.

New CoD Mobile Battle Royale class in CoD Mobile Season 9
Get ready to soar through the skies in CoD Mobile’s battle royale playlist. ‘Pumped’ is an all-new class that’s landed in the Season 9 patch; one that gives your character a functioning jet pack.
With the Power Jump Active Skill and the Pump Up Passive Skill you’re able to leap into the air and reach new heights. Not only does this completely buff your mobility, but it also lets you fire on enemies from new angles.
CoD Mobile Season 9 Trick or Treat event
It wouldn’t be a new CoD Mobile season without a new limited-time event. As Season 9 is doubling down on its Halloween theme, the latest mode is a trick-or-treat special.

All you have to do is “go door to door,” visiting your friend’s rooms online. Upon interacting with them, you’ll either be tricked or treated. If you land on a trick, you have to complete “an in-game task to get your candy.” But if you’re treated, that candy becomes available right away.
